76ers' Oubre Crashes Car After Knicks Loss, No Injuries

Photo: Instagram/Kelly Oubre Jr. Philadelphia 76ers' guard Kelly Oubre Jr. had a rough night after the team's Game 2 loss against the New York Knicks. Oubre reportedly crashed his Lamborghini by running a red light, colliding with another car. The incident happened around 1:45 a.m. on Tuesday, with both vehicles towed from the scene. Fortunately, no injuries were reported. Photo: Instagram/Kelly Oubre Jr. Oubre commented, "Everything is good," acknowledging the need for a driver in the future. This mishap followed the Sixers' tough loss to the Knicks, where Oubre scored only 4 points. However, the team redeemed themselves with a 125-114 victory in Game 3, led by Joel Embiid 's 50-point performance, supported by Oubre's 15 points and seven rebounds. Tyrese Maxey Ignites 76ers With Career-High 50-Point Performance, Propelling Team To 8-1 Record

Photo: Instagram/Tyrese Maxey In a stunning display of offensive prowess, Tyrese Maxey led the Philadelphia 76ers to a 137-126 victory over the Indiana Pacers, securing an impressive 8-1 start to the season.  Maxey's career-high 50 points, coupled with Joel Embiid 's remarkable 37-point, 13-rebound, seven-assist contribution, marked a highlight reel for the 76ers in this young NBA season. The 76ers' 8-1 record is their best start since 2001 when they achieved a remarkable 10-0 record on their way to the NBA Finals. Photo: Instagram/Tyrese Maxey Maxey's explosive performance comes amid the absence of James Harden, solidifying his role as a potent offensive force for the team. Efficient and dynamic, Maxey connected on 20 of 32 field goals, including an impressive 7 of 11 from 3-point range. Philadelphia 76ers' Kelly Oubre Jr. Struck By Vehicle, Hospitalized With Injuries

Photo: Instagram/Kelly Oubre Jr. In a shocking turn of events, 76ers guard Kelly Oubre Jr. was struck by a vehicle on Saturday evening near his residence in downtown Philadelphia.  The incident occurred at the intersection of Broad and Locust streets in Center City around 7 p.m. Oubre, 27, sustained undisclosed injuries and was promptly transported to Jefferson Hospital in stable condition.
